Mahindra recently launched the XUV 3XO in the Indian market. It is essentially a heavily updated version of the XUV300. Now, the brand has opened bookings for the XUV 3XO online on the website and at authorised dealerships as well. Mahindra has also announced that they will be commencing deliveries of the sub-compact SUV from 26th May. Having said that, interested customers can already check out the XUV 3X0 at the nearby dealerships.

The XUV 3X0 will be offered with three engine options. There is a 1.2-litre turbo petrol engine, a 1.2-litre petrol engine with direct-injection and a 1.5-litre diesel engine. The direct-injection petrol engine puts out 128 bhp of max power and a peak torque output of 230 Nm. The turbo petrol produces 108 bhp and 200 Nm whereas the diesel engine puts out 115 bhp and 300 Nm.

As standard, all engines come mated to a 6-speed manual gearbox whereas the diesel engine also gets a 6-speed AMT. What’s new for the 3XO is the 6-speed torque converter automatic transmission that is now available on both petrol engines.

Mahindra is offering the XUV 3XO in nine variants. The prices start at 7.49 lakh and go up to 15.49 lakh. Both prices are ex-showroom. The main rivals of the XUV 3XO are the Kia Sonet, Tata Nexon, Maruti Suzuki Brezza, Hyundai Venue and the upcoming compact SUV from Skoda.

Some of the highlights of the XUV 3XO are the panoramic sunroof which is the largest in the segment, there is a 360-degree parking camera, dual-zone climate control and auto hold with an electronic parking brake. Then there is the addition of Level 2 ADAS. The hardware is shared with the XUV700. Moreover, there are also three steering modes – Comfort, Normal and Sport.

Kia India has announced that the Sonet has received a significant milestone of surpassing 4 lakh sales figures in under 44 months. It is important to note that these sales figures include domestic and overseas markets. The Sonet commands 33.3 per cent overall sales with 3,17,754 units sold domestically and 85,814 units exported. The updated Sonet was launched in India in January 2024. The price

In 44 months since launch, 63 per cent of customers prefer Sonet variants equipped with a sunroof. Regarding engine preference, Sonet’s 1.5-litre diesel engine is preferred by 37% of its customers which is quite surprising as the market for diesel engines is slowly dying. 63 per cent of customers prefer petrol engine options. Kia has also observed a consumer shift towards automatic variants. This is probably because of the increasing traffic that our cities are facing. The 7-speed dual-clutch automatic transmission in Sonet has gained traction, growing by 37.50 per cent since 2020. While automatic transmissions (7DCT & 6AT) contribute 28 per cent, the iMT has a steady fanbase with a 23 per cent sales contribution to Sonet. In the iMT gearbox, the driver needs to change the gears but doesn’t have to engage or disengage the clutch pedal.

Toyota Urban Cruiser Taisor is essentially a rebadged iteration of the Maruti Suzuki Fronx. This crossover comes as the latest product under the Suzuki-Toyota global agreement for model and technology sharing.

Toyota Urban Cruiser Taisor has been launched as the latest entrant in the Indian passenger vehicle market’s compact segment. It is basically a rebadged version of the Maruti Suzuki Fronx, which was launched last year as a crossover based on the Maruti Suzuki Baleno premium hatchback. Toyota and Maruti Suzuki both have already launched multiple cars in India, which come under the Suzuki-Toyota global agreement for model and technology sharing. The Taisor comes as the latest addition to the list.

The Toyota Urban Cruiser Taisor has been launched in a segment that has been witnessing fierce competition from multiple OEMs. The compact SUV and crossover segment has been witnessing ever-increasing demand, fuelling the OEMs to introduce a range of products in this space. Taisor comes as part of that wave. The crossover competes with rivals such as Tata Nexon, Kia Sonet, Hyundai Venue etc.

Here is a price and specification-based comparison between the Toyota Urban Cruiser Taisor and Hyundai Venue.

Toyota Urban Cruiser Taisor vs Hyundai Venue: Price

Toyota Urban Cruiser Taisor is priced between 7.73 lakh and 13.03 lakh (ex-showroom). On the other hand, the Hyundai Venue comes priced between 7.94 lakh and 13.48 lakh (ex-showroom).

Toyota Urban Cruiser Taisor vs Hyundai Venue: Specifications

The newly launched Toyota Urban Cruiser Taisor crossover comes available in two different petrol engine options. There is a 1.2-litre petrol engine and a 1.0-litre turbocharged petrol motor. The 1.2-litre naturally aspirated petrol engine is available with a CNG combination as well. The 1.2-litre petrol engine churns out 88.5 bhp peak power and 113 Nm maximum torque in petrol-only mode, while in CNG mode, it offers 76.44 bhp power and 98.5 Nm torque. The 1.0-litre turbocharged petrol engine generates 98.6 bhp power and 147.6 Nm torque. Transmission options for the crossover include a five-speed manual unit, a five-speed AMT and a six-speed automatic gearbox.

Hyundai Venue is available in both petrol and diesel options. The Venue gets a 1.2-litre petrol engine and a 1.0-litre turbocharged petrol engine, while there is a 1.5-litre diesel motor on offer as well. The naturally aspirated 1.2-litre petrol engine is available with a five-speed manual transmission and generates 82 bhp peak power and 113.8 Nm torque. The turbocharged petrol motor is available with a six-speed manual gearbox, while there is a seven-speed DCT option as well. This engine churns out 118 bhp peak power and 172 Nm torque. The diesel motor on the other hand is available with a six-speed manual gearbox and pumps out 114 bhp peak power and 250 Nm of torque.

The Executive Turbo trim comes with 16-inch dual-tone stylized wheels, dark chrome on the grille, roof rails, shark fin antenna and an ‘Executive’ emblem on the tailgate. The interior gets a front centre armrest with storage, 2-step rear reclining seats, 60:40 split seats and adjustable headrests for all passengers.

There is an 8-inch touchscreen infotainment system, which comes with wireless Android Auto and Apple CarPlay and voice recognition. There is also a digital cluster with a TFT MID for the driver.

For safety, there are 6 airbags, 3 point seatbelts with seat belt reminders, Electronic Stability Control, Vehicle Stability Management, Hill Assist Control, automatic headlamps, tyre pressure monitoring system etc.

Powering the new variant is the same 1.0-litre three-cylinder turbocharged petrol engine. It puts out 118 bhp of max power at 6,000 rpm and a peak torque output of 172 Nm at 1,500 to 4,000 rpm. The Executive Turbo is only available with a 6-speed manual transmission. The engine also comes with an Idle Start/Stop system to enhance fuel efficiency.

Also Read : Hyundai Ioniq 5 facelift EV debuts with new N Line variant: See what has changed

Hyundai has also updated the Venue S (O) Turbo variant with an electric sunroof and map lamps for the passenger and the driver. This variant is available with a 6-speed manual gearbox and a 7-speed dual-clutch automatic transmission.

2024 Kia Sonet facelift: Engine and transmission

Just like earlier, the Sonet facelift will be available in three engine options. There will be a naturally aspirated petrol engine, a diesel engine and a turbo-petrol engine on offer.

The naturally aspirated petrol engine will get a 5-speed manual gearbox. Kia is claiming a fuel efficiency figure of 18.83 kmpl. The turbo-petrol engine which will be offered with a 6-speed intelligent manual gearbox and a 7-speed dual-clutch automatic transmission. The fuel efficiency figures are rated at 18.7 kmpl and 19.2 kmpl respectively.

The diesel engine gets a 6-speed intelligent manual gearbox with a fuel efficiency figure of 22.3 kmpl, there will also be a 6-speed torque converter automatic transmission rated for a fuel efficiency figure of 18.6 kmpl. Finally, there will be a 6-speed manual gearbox whose fuel efficiency figures have not been unveiled because it is still under certification.

The Maruti Suzuki Brezza was launched as the Vitara Brezza in March 2016 and went on to achieve the one million sales milestone in December 2023

Maruti Suzuki has recorded a new milestone with one of its most popular SUVs as the Brezza clocked over 10 lakh units in sales. The achievement comes within eight months since the subcompact SUV crossed the nine lakh sales mark. The automaker achieved the landmark figure in a total of 94 months or seven years and eight months, since the first generation Maruti Suzuki Vitara Brezza went on sale in March 2016.

As of November 2023, Maruti Suzuki had sold 996,608 units of the Brezza and would need an additional 3,392 units to hit the one million milestone, which the company achieved in early December. Now in its second generation, the SUV has been a top seller right from the start averaging monthly sales of nearly 14,000 units every month.

The Maruti Suzuki Brezza has also been the top-selling subcompact SUV in the country surpassing rivals like the Tata Nexon, Kia Sonet, Hyundai Venue, Mahindra XUV300 and the like. Notably, the Nexon is the only other SUV to have sales of more than one lakh units in FY2024 so far in the segment.

Maruti Suzuki clocked the one lakh sales milestone in March 2017 within a year of the Vitara Brezza’s launch. The subcompact SUV went on to hit the five lakh sales mark in January 2020, 46 months since its launch. The remaining five lakh units were achieved in just under 47 months, showcasing the same consistency in sales.

While the first generation Maruti Suzuki Vitara Brezza was a diesel-only offering with a 1.3-litre oil burner, the carmaker changed that when the facelift arrived in 2020 plonking the 1.5-litre petrol engine. The automaker went on to add a CNG option in March this year, which pushed sales further amidst rising fuel prices. This helped the SUV claim the top spot in the segment, which it lost out to the Nexon in FY2022 and FY2023.

Maruti Suzuki also showcased the idea of a Brezza CNG automatic at the 2023 Auto Expo but the model has not yet been greenlit for production. The company’s UV offerings have been a massive success and helped Maruti to take the throne of the number one SUV maker in the country from Mahindra this year. The brand’s other SUVs include the Fronx, Jimny, and Grand Vitara

Tata Motors launched the 2023 Nexon facelift SUV in India on September 14 at a starting price of ₹8.10 lakh (ex-showroom).

According to the fuel efficiency figures revealed by Tata Motors, the petrol variants of the Nexon SUV with manual and dual-clutch transmission options offer mileage of 17.01 kmpl. The Nexon petrol variants with the AMT gearbox offers 17.44 kmpl of mileage. In diesel version, the Nexon offers at least 23.23 kmpl in variants offered with manual transmission. The variants which are offered with AMT gearbox, offers up to 24.01 kmpl of mileage.

In comparison, Hyundai Venue diesel variants come close to the new Nexon’s fuel efficiency figures. Offered with manual transmission, Venue diesel variants offer mileage of 23.4 kmpl. Kia Sonet diesel variants, which are offered with automatic transmission, offer fuel efficiency of 18.2 kmpl. Mahindra XUV300 is the other SUV in the sub-compact segment which if offered with diesel engine. It offers mileage of 20.1 kmpl in manual variants and 19.07 kmpl in automatic versions.

Also watch: Tata Nexon facelift first drive review – the best-seller adds more glamour

The new Nexon is offered with both petrol and diesel variants. The 1.5-litre turbo diesel unit comes mated to either a six-speed manual or an AMT gearbox. The engine can churn out 113 bhp of power and 260 Nm of peak torque. The 1.2-litre turbo petrol engine comes mated with four transmission choices. These include a five-speed manual, a six-speed manual, a six-speed AMT and a DCT gearbox. The engine can generate 118 bhp of power and 170 Nm of peak torque.

Besides the Hyundai Venue, Kia Sonet and Mahindra XUV300, the Nexon facelift SUV also rivals the likes of Maruti Suzuki Brezza in the sub-compact segment. However. Maruti Suzuki does not offer any diesel engine anymore. The Brezza, powered by a 1.5-litre petrol unit, offers up to 19.8 kmpl of mileage in the automatic variants.

Hyundai Motor India Limited (HMIL) has announced that they have received more than 50,000 bookings for the Exter. Bookings grew from 10,000 to 50,000 in just 30 days of launch. Hyundai has also revealed that more than one-third of the bookings are for the AMT variants. Hyundai Exter’s main rival is the Tata Punch. The Exter is currently priced between 6 lakh and 10 lakh. Both prices are ex-showroom and introductory.

By: Paarth Khatri
| Updated on: 09 Aug 2023, 14:21 PM

Hyundai Exter is the tallest and has the longest wheelbase in its segment. (HT Auto/Sabyasachi Dasgupta)

The Exter is being sold in seven variants. There is EX, EX(O), S, S(O), SX, SX(O) and SX(O) Connect. Hyundai Exter is offered with a 3-year (unlimited kilometres warranty) along with an option of 7 years of extended warranty. The micro SUV is available with 6 Monotone and 3 Dual tone exterior colour options.

The Exter really made a mark in the market by offering several segment-first features. It comes with footwell lighting, metal pedals, a shark-fin antenna, a smart electric sunroof, a dashcam with dual cameras, a wireless charger, rear AC vents, premium floor mats, paddle shifters, on-board navigation and support for multiple languages.

Powering the Exter is a 1.2-litre, four-cylinder naturally aspirated engine that is doing duty on other Hyundai models. It produces 81.86 bhp of max power and 113.8 Nm of peak torque. While running on CNG, these figures are reduced to 68 bhp and 95.2 Nm. The max power arrives at 6,000 rpm while the peak torque output arrives at 4,000 rpm.

The Petrol powertrain comes mated to a 5-speed manual gearbox or a 5-speed AMT. The CNG powertrain only gets a 5-speed manual gearbox. The engine is quite smooth and refined. Moreover, the manual gearbox also slots in with a positive feel and while the AMT gearbox shifts with a minimal head nod, making it one of the best AMTs in the market. Interestingly, the Exter AMT is also offered with paddle shifters.

Hyundai Motor India Ltd (HMIL), on Tuesday, announced that it cumulatively sold 66,701 cars in July 2023. This marks a 4.46 per cent growth compared to the South Korean automaker’s sales numbers posted in July last year when it registered 63,851 units. In the domestic market, Hyundai India recorded 50,701 units in July this year, registering a marginal growth as compared to 50,500 units sold in the same month a year ago.

By: HT Auto Desk
| Updated on: 01 Aug 2023, 12:46 PM

The range of SUVs has helped the automaker to post significant growth in sales in July 2023.

While domestic market sales for Hyundai India have witnessed marginal growth, export numbers for the car manufacturer have seen a substantial surge in sales with 16,000 units sold last month, up by 19.84 per cent from 13,351 units sold in the same month a year ago.
